Although “hip hop” was barely recognized as a musical style as recently as three decades ago, the rap genre has undergone phenomenal growth and recognition within recent years. Its urban rhythms have become sound tracks of daily life, and many of its once-controversial, provocative lyrics have entered the lexicon of the cultural mainstream. A group of young men from Compton, California, performing West Coast hip hop as “N.W.A.,” were at the forefront of the art’s refinement in presentation and its subsequent rise in popularity. N.W.A. played a pioneering role amid societal evolution, and individual members of the band went on to enjoy highly successful careers in entertainment and other realms.

The original album from 1988 – “Straight Outta Compton,” by N.W.A. – is presented. Published under the groups’s Ruthless Records label, the record featured eleven tracks, including “Gangsta Gangsta” and “---- the Police.” (The latter song – highlighting confrontation with law enforcement – was seen at the time as particularly incendiary.) The album achieved platinum status, and is widely heralded as one of the Greatest Hip Hop albums of all time. Still much appreciated by contemporary audiences, the album and its subjects inspired a hit 2015 motion picture that shares the same title.

The front of the cardboard album cover has been signed in gold or silver paint pen by four of the group’s original members, including:

Ice Cube: inscribed, “NWA”;                                                  

Dr. Dre: Inscribed, “To Phono Booth / Keep rockin that good shit/ NWA”;

EAZY-E: Deceased 1995, at age 31. Inscribed, “Thankz 4 your support / N.W.A”;

M.C. Ren: Inscribed, “To the Phono Booth / The Ruthless Villain / N.W.A.”

The Original vinyl LP is included. Full LOA from JSA.
